Concrete Path Installation in Denver, CO
Concrete path installation services involve creating durable and attractive walkways, patios, or garden paths using concrete materials. These projects typically include designing and constructing pathways that complement existing landscaping, improve accessibility, or define outdoor spaces. Property owners often want to understand the different styles and finishes available, the durability of concrete for outdoor use, and the typical steps involved in installation to ensure a smooth and long-lasting result.
Before requesting concrete path installation, homeowners should consider the size, shape, and location of the desired pathway, as well as any drainage or grading requirements. It’s also helpful to think about the type of concrete finish, such as stamped, exposed aggregate, or smooth, to match the aesthetic of the property. Understanding the necessary preparation work, potential maintenance needs, and how the new path will integrate with existing features can help property owners make informed decisions about their outdoor improvements.

Concrete Path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for concrete path installation? Concrete paths are ideal for walkways, patios, driveways, and garden borders around residential properties.
How long does a concrete path typ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, concrete paths can last 20 years or more.
Are there design options available for concrete paths? Yes, options include stamped patterns, colors, and textured finishes to enhance visual appeal.
What should property owners consider before installing a concrete path? Factors include the intended use, location, soil conditions, and drainage requirements.
